Helping you decide on the best transmission type for Moroccan roads.

This is probably the most common question we get, and there's no one-size-fits-all answer. Let me break down the real-world differences. Manual cars dominate Morocco - they're what most locals drive, they're cheaper to rent (20-30% less), and honestly, they're more fun on open roads and mountain passes where you want control over gears. If you learned to drive manual, you'll have no problems here. The roads outside cities are often empty stretches where manual is actually more engaging. That said, Marrakech traffic can be intense. Roundabouts, motorbikes weaving around, people crossing everywhere - if you're not confident with manual in heavy traffic, it gets stressful. This is where automatic transmission shines. You can focus on navigation and other drivers without worrying about stalling at lights or clutch control on hills. For elderly drivers or those with knee issues, automatic is much more comfortable on long drives. Automatic cars are also better if you're doing a lot of city driving or if multiple drivers will share duties and not everyone is confident with manual. The fuel efficiency difference is negligible in modern cars. Availability is the thing - automatic cars are less common, so book early, especially in peak season. They're also typically only available in mid-range to luxury vehicles. For mountain driving, manual gives you better engine braking control on descents, which is safer. For desert sand driving in a 4x4, you want manual to control wheel spin. Bottom line: if you're confident with manual and it's just highway/countryside driving, go manual and save money. If you're doing heavy city driving or aren't comfortable with manual transmissions, the extra cost for automatic is worth the reduced stress and smoother experience.
